    Just to add, I was wondering why you had port 53 opened to your DNS servers. And just to point out, that rule you created is a port translation rule that allows access to your DNS server from the internet, just as if you had created a rule to allow access
    to an internal web server for public use, or for allowing webmail (OWA) access from the internet to your internal mail server.
    What you did, as Keith said, will stop that, but to further point out, the rules are not really needed again, I would just remove the rules completely. For internet access, such as allowing your users to access websites, your DNS to resolve external names
    (whether using Root hints or a Forwarder), just about any firewall will allow that out-of-the-box. In some firewalls, you have to create a rule to the outside untrusted interface to "allow established" meaning when an internal request goes to an outside resource,
    such as a website, to allow the response back in.
    The only time you want to create rules is either you want to allow inbound traffic with a port translation rule (such as what you originally unknowingly did for TCP & UDP 53) to a web server, OWA, SMTP traffic to a mail server, etc.), otherwise,
    leave it out of the box.
    As for what the ISP is concerned about regarding DNS amplification attacks, is that they are a fairly recent method for attackers to create a DOS (denial of service). You can read up at a couple of recent discussions about what all that means in
    the following threads, with ways to stop or mitigate them.

  • DNS Resolver not working with JDK 1.5.0_6 and Windows 2003

    I have a Windows Server 2003 machine which now has Java JDK 1.5.0_6 installed on it. Somehow the DNS resolver doesn't work - every call to InetAddress.getByName("host") throws an UnknownHostException. I've tried de-installed java and re-installing, but the problem remains. No traffic seems to be generated (i.e. no packets to port 53) when getByName() is called. I don't have any kind of firewall on the Windows Server 2003 machine.
    Has anyone ever seen this kind of behaviour / problem before and know of a solution?
    Thanks,
    Peter

    Ok, I finally managed to solve this problem. What was happening was that IPv6 was installed on this computer, and as a result Java was trying to do a DNS lookup using a IPv6 socket and failing. With the help of TracePlus Winsock, I discovered that internall Java's InetAddress.getByName does this:
    WSAStartup
    socket(INET6)
    getaddrinfo
    WSACleanup
    Two solutions are possible - either set the system preference java.net.preferIPv4Stack to true, or uninstall the IPv6 stack. Since I couldn't find a way to set the system preference in a persistent manner (apart from passing in an argument on the java command line), I uninstalled the IPv6 stack.
    Hope this helps someone else.
